Hideaway
Mousse and Louis are young, beautiful, rich and in love. But drugs have invaded their lives. One day, they overdose and Louis dies. Mousse survives, but soon learns she’s pregnant. Feeling lost, Mousse runs away to a house far from Paris. Several months later, Louis’ brother joins her in her refuge.
The Winning Season
From director James C. Strouse (Grace is Gone) comes The Winning Season, starring Sam Rockwell as an adult misfit who is brought on to coach the local girl’s high school basketball team.
